The purpose of the study is to determine whether in patients with early type 2 diabetes, a short-term intensive metabolic intervention comprising Forxiga, metformin, basal insulin glargine and lifestyle approaches will be superior to standard diabetes therapy in achieving sustained diabetes remission.

This is a multicentre, open-label, randomized controlled trial in 152 patients with recently-diagnosed T2DM. Participants will be randomized to 2 treatment groups: (a) a 12-week course of treatment with Forxiga, metformin, insulin glargine and lifestyle therapy, and (b) standard diabetes therapy, and followed for a total of 64 weeks (1 year and 3 months). In all participants with HbA1C<7.3% at the 12 week visit, glucose-lowering medications will be discontinued and participants will be encouraged to continue with lifestyle modifications and regular glucose monitoring. Participants with HbA1C ≥ 7.3% at this visit or who experience hyperglycemia relapse after stopping drugs will receive standard glycemic management as informed by the current Canadian Diabetes Association clinical practice guidelines.
